where was jesus baptized
jordan river
who baptized jesus
john the baptist
why is john reluctant to baptize jesus
he does not think he has sinned
what happens after jesus was baptized
a dove descends from the sky
what was the original purpose of baptism
trying to get rid of sins
what is the purpose of an initiation process (christianity)
prepare a person to become fully christian, teach beliefs, values, and practices and help develop relationship with god
what is the purpose of an initiation process
mark transition in life stage, help a person become part of a new group/role, create a sense of belonging
symbols in baptism
water and font, baptismal garment, candle, oil, and chrism
ruah
wing and breath of god
7 gifts of the holy spirit
wisdom, understanding, right judgement, courage, knowledge, reverence, and wonder and awe
wisdom
using god’s guidance to make good decisions
understanding
trying to act appropriately based on someone’s situation
right judgement
knowing the right thing to do and giving wise advice while recognizing your own limits
courage
knowing when to stand up for what is right
knowledge
understanding truths about god, faith, and the world
reverence
showing absolute respect towards god and others
wonder and awe
recognizing god’s greatness and feeling amazement for his power and creation
how did the apostles demeanor change before and after the holy spirit
fearful and in hiding before pentecost
received the holy spirit and became confident and filled with faith
eucharist translation
thanksgiving; agape
transubstantiation
transformation of bread and wine into the body and blood of jesus christ
not symbolic
when jesus celebrates the eucharist, what jewish celebration is he celebrating with his apostles
passover (seder meal)
shows jesus was a devout jewish man
what is the hopeful message of the pascal mystery
jesus’ suffering, death, resurrection, and ascension bring salvation and new life
sin and death do not have the final victory
what did the original sacrament of initiation look like
baptism, confirmation and eucharist were all received in same celebration during easter vigil
catechumen
a person preparing to become a christian by learning the faith and living in formation
mystagogy
time after a person becomes fully initiated into the church
new catholics reflect on sacraments and learn how to live as a christian
